Loyal R. Mapes

Loyal Mapes photoLoyal R. Mapes, 93, Hays, died Thursday, July 24, 2014 at Via Christi Villages in Hays.

He was born March 7, 1921 in rural Norton County, Kansas the son of Elmer and Blanche (Mathes) Mapes. He graduated from Norton Community High School in 1938. He married Beulah States October 3, 1940. He then entered into the United States Army in 1942 and was honorably discharged in 1944, awarded the Purple Heart. Beulah died September 17, 1992 and Loyal later married Creta Bennett on March 20, 1993. Creta died on March 12, 2014. He was a member of the First Church of God and American Legion Post 63 in Norton. He also loved fishing, hunting, spending time watching birds, and riding in the parades in his 1929 Ford.

He was survived by his son, Eldon Mapes and wife Phyllis, Baldwin City, a daughter, Leta Rice and husband Larry, Laferia, TX, four grandchildren, Daveda Leppke and husband Kent, Bonner Springs, Evan Mapes, Houston, TX, Melissa Russell and husband Travis, Wichita, Brant Rice and wife DeLynn, Hays, and seven great grandchildren, Brandon and Danae Leppke, Landry, Kelly and Chloe Rice, Cooper and Bryles Russell, a sister, Dorothy Goodon, Toney, AL, and a brother-in-law, Earl Wright.

He was preceded in death by wife Beulah and wife Creta, two brothers, and four sisters.
